River came to us from a remote reserve after she was hit by a car and couldn't walk. After 4 1/2 hours of surgery we are happy to say she is doing great! The lower half of her right leg had 3 breaks in it and they ended up wrapping it with a wire and using a pin to realign 2 bones down her leg, They used a stabilizer plate on the bone then realigned her pelvis bone and put screws in there. Dr. Smith said it looks great and all the tools they used to fix her will just stay inside of her. She will be on straight bed rest for the next 3 weeks to let things heal. After that she will slowly start walking. When 6 weeks are up she will go back for more xrays to make sure everything has healed and to say her goodbyes to the amazing staff. We are so glad everything worked out for this girl and she will have all 4 legs in life.

This girl came into our care in the summer of 2021. She was just a pup, about 4 to 5 months old, when she was hit by a car and her leg was smashed. Dr. Mat at Crossroads Vet Clinic operated on her and removed her leg. Within hours she was standing! What a trouper! It is amazing the pain tolerance in these northern dogs. She is now on the road to recovery. Big thanks to Crossroads for all that you did to help her. Lady is going to have the best life ever now.
Paws was told of a dog at a reserve who had heart worm and that the owner had decided to surrender him because she couldn't keep him anymore. We brought Cash to TBay, found a foster home for him, and with the help of Crossroads Vet Clinic, have provided him with heartworm medication. This is a very costly venture - which Paws will cover - and his new owners will have to be very diligent in keeping Cash calm and at ease so no complications occur.
